Checking/Operating the Top Menu

Displaying/Operating the Status Screen
The status screen of the top menu is displayed on the LCD panel when you turn on the device.

1
Camera Number, Group Name
The selected camera number and group name are
displayed.
2
Screen Name
The screen name of the currently displayed top
menu is displayed.
3
Direct Setting Mode (P. 32)
Shooting mode, white balance, ISO/gain and
shutter speed settings are displayed and can be
changed.
4
Color Adjustment Settings
White balance (R gain/B gain), Master Black (Red/
Blue) and Master Pedestal setting values are
displayed.
6 7
5
Assigned Functions for the F1-F4 Dials and
Setting Values
Turning each dial adjusts the values of the
corresponding functions. Displayed in gray when
disabled. If the selected camera is not equipped
with the corresponding function, or if
disconnected, "–" is displayed.
6
Authentication Warning
Displayed when the currently selected camera
could not be authenticated with the administrator/
user name and password. Additionally,
displayed on SYSTEM menu > [Camera Connect.
Details] tab > [Administrator Name/User Name]
and [Password].
